David Schrader

Lecturer in Technical Design and Production and Properties Craftsperson

David Schrader has been Properties Craftsman for the Yale Repertory Theatre since 1988. Prior to working at Yale, he was Technical Director and a scenic designer at Brown University with the Department of Theatre, Speech, and Dance and with the Afro-American Studies Program. From 1991 through 2012 he served as scenic designer, production supervisor, and properties master with the Papermill Theatre, North Country Center for the Arts’ summer production company, in Lincoln, New Hampshire. Mr. Schrader is also a freelance designer and craftsperson for theater and commercial projects specializing in furniture renovation. He holds a B.A. (1975) from Iowa State University.
